Permissions question
I have a strange permissions event occurring here. Running 11.2/KDE4. When
I plug in a USB drive and try to open it with dolphin I get a pop-up telling
me I don't have permission to open the device, asking for root pw. If I
tell it to "Ignore", dophin proceeds to open and I have full rw access to
the drive. What permission/group setting do I need to modify to get rid of
that annoying - seemingly meaningless - pop up? Seems silly to ask for root
pw then give access after the "ignore" selection.
